I am very pleased to be able to invite you to a symposium on improving education, training and employment outcomes for care leavers in Southampton.
Young people who leave local authority care have often experienced immense disruption as children. In our city, we have a firm commitment to helping them have happy and fulfilling lives as adults. Opportunities to work and progress are very much part of that.
